About this role
Double Good is a leading fundraising app and best-in-class technology company redefining how youth organizations raise funds for the causes they care about. Teams run short, high-impact fundraisers by selling delicious popcorn through personalized Pop-Up Stores, keeping 50% of every sale. Thousands of schools and teams nationwide use Double Good to raise meaningful funds quickly and easily.
Guided by our mission to create joy, Double Good also supports the Double Good Kids Foundation, a 501(c)(3) organization that exists to spark joy for children with special needs and the people who care for them through inclusive experiences and spaces that foster play, connection, and possibility.
Double Good has been recognized on the Inc. 5000 list 18 times and ranked No. 13 on Crain’s Chicago Business Fast 50 list in 2025, and it continues to grow while staying focused on impact.

About the role:
The Senior Talent Management Specialist plays a key role in bringing Double Good's people strategy to life by executing talent management and employee experience programs that support our culture and purpose to Create Joy. Through thoughtful program execution, continuous improvement, and cross-functional collaboration, this role creates meaningful experiences that help team members learn, grow, and thrive throughout the employee lifecycle.
As a member of the Talent Management team, the Senior Talent Management Specialist executes and continuously improves core talent and employee experience programs, including teammate development programs, culture-building experiences, new hire onboarding, employee engagement initiatives, and performance management. This role partners across the People Team to deliver high-quality programs and intentionally integrate Double Good’s Values into every team member experience, creating meaningful moments that support our culture and company’s continued growth.
Scope and Range:
- This is a highly collaborative individual contributor role responsible for executing key employee experience programs that support team member growth, engagement, and organizational culture. The Senior Talent Management Specialist partners across the People team to deliver impactful, scalable experiences throughout the employee lifecycle.
Responsibilities:
- Coordinate the planning and execution of employee experience programs by managing project plans, vendor partnerships, logistics, and other operational elements that deliver a seamless team member experience.
- Support the administration of employee engagement surveys, including survey setup, system administration, action planning, and program logistics.
- Ownership of Double Good’s onboarding program, including content development and delivery, to create an engaging, scalable experience that equips new team members for success and brings Living Double Good to life from day one.
- Deliver engaging learning and development programs that equip teammates with the knowledge, skills, and resources to succeed in their roles.
- Manage the UKG Learning Management System (LMS), including learning path creation, compliance training administration, and ongoing system maintenance.
- Coordinate the execution of Double Good’s performance management cycle, including goal setting, mid-year and year-end reviews, through system administration, reporting, and program logistics.
- Support the execution of additional People Team initiatives, including company-wide events such as the annual recognition celebration, as well as managing swag for service anniversaries, employee appreciation, and other company events.
Experience & Skills we value:
Required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Organizational Development, Business Administration, Psychology, or a related field, or equivalent professional experience. 5+ years of experience in Talent Management, Employee Experience, Human Resources, Organization Development, Learning & Development, or a related field.
- Experience supporting Talent Management programs such as performance management processes and employee engagement surveys.
- Strong facilitation and presentation skills, with experience delivering engaging learning experiences to diverse audiences.
- Experience designing, delivering, and continuously improving onboarding programs that create engaging and impactful new hire experiences.
- Experience administering a Learning Management System (LMS).
- Strong project management and organizational skills with that 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ills with the ability to build strong relationships across all levels of the organization.
- Strong attention to detail, analytical skills, and a continuous improvement mindset.
Nice to have and/or you’ll learn:
- Bilingual fluency in English and Spanish (written and verbal).
- Experience with UKG Learning Management System.
- DiSC certification or experience facilitating DiSC workshops.
- Experience coordinating and supporting Employee Resource Groups (ERGs).

Base Pay range for this position:
- $73,000 - $104,000 annually
- Target Annual Bonus: 10% of base salary
The final discretionary compensation that will be offered for this role depends on a variety of factors, including job-related knowledge, skills, experience, and market location.
